/** * This helper method loads just the .dbf file header portion into the mapTable argument using the * dis stream. * * @param dis The stream reading from the .dbf file. * @param mapTable The dbf table being loadd. * @throws IOException Thrown when the stream fails. */ private void loadHeader(DataInputStream dis, DBFTable mapTable) throws IOException { // DBF file type (0) byte dbfFileType = dis.readByte(); mapTable.setFileType(dbfFileType); // LAST UPDATE (1-3) int year = 1900 + dis.readByte(); int month = dis.readByte(); int day = dis.readByte(); mapTable.setLastModifiedDate(year, month, day); // NUMBER OF RECORDS IN FILE (4-7) int numberOfRecordsInFile = readLittleEndianInt(dis); mapTable.setNumberOfRecords(numberOfRecordsInFile); // POSITION OF FIRST DATA RECORDED (8-9) short positionOfFirstDataRecorded = readLittleEndianShort(dis); mapTable.setPositionOfFirstDataRecorded(positionOfFirstDataRecorded); // LENGTH OF ONE DATA RECORD, INCLUDING DELETE FLAG (10-11) short dataRecordLength = readLittleEndianShort(dis); mapTable.setDataRecordLength(dataRecordLength); // ZEROES (12-13) short zeroes = readLittleEndianShort(dis); mapTable.setZeroes(zeroes); // DBASE IV Transaction Flag (14) byte dbaseTransactionFlag = dis.readByte(); mapTable.setDbaseTransactionFlag(dbaseTransactionFlag); // DBASE IV Encryption Flag (15) byte dbaseEncryptionFlag = dis.readByte(); mapTable.setDbaseEncryptionFlag(dbaseEncryptionFlag); // Multiuser Processing 12 Bytes (16-27) int[] mup = new int[3]; mup[0] = readLittleEndianInt(dis); mup[1] = readLittleEndianInt(dis); mup[2] = readLittleEndianInt(dis); mapTable.setMup(mup); // TABLE FLAGS (28) byte tableFlags = dis.readByte(); mapTable.setFlags(tableFlags); // CODE PAGE MARK/LANGUAGE DRIVER ID (29) byte pageMark = dis.readByte(); mapTable.setCodePageMark(pageMark); // RESERVED, CONTAINS 0x00 (30-31) short reserved = readLittleEndianShort(dis); mapTable.setReserved(reserved); }
